feat: show projected runestone gain persistently in resource bar
Adds computeProjectedRunestones() to the shared tick engine using the correct server-side formula (cbrt, (count+1)^2 threshold). The resource bar now shows a persistent '+N On Prestige' row so players can always see what they would earn. The prestige panel's own preview was also fixed to use the shared helper, replacing a broken local calculation that used sqrt and the wrong threshold formula. Closes #168
